> Allow the TIME type in the Parquet datasource which was disabled by 
> SPARK-51590. Support TimeType in vectorized and non-vectorized readers as 
> well as in the writer.
> Write tests for:
> - the read path. Create a parquet file using an external library, and read it 
> back by Spark SQL.
> - the write path: write TIME values to parquet and read it back.
